Factory Automation Platform As A Service Market Size 2025-2029

The factory automation platform as a service market size is forecast to increase by USD 56.67 billion at a CAGR of 46.8% between 2024 and 2029.

What are the key market drivers leading to the rise in the adoption of Factory Automation Platform As A Service Industry?

Ease of IT and OT convergence is the key driver of the market.

  • The market is witnessing significant growth due to the integration of information technology (IT) and operational technology (OT) through cloud-based platforms. IT comprises physical storage, networking devices, and computers, while OT includes industrial control systems such as DCS, SCADA, and PLC. The traditional separation of IT and OT communication networks is being bridged by digital platforms based on open APIs and agile application architectures using containers or micro-services. The increasing adoption of the Internet of Things (IoT) in discrete manufacturing industries, including automotive, semiconductor, and electronics, necessitates the streamlining of factory automation software and solutions with digital platforms.

What challenges does the Factory Automation Platform As A Service Industry face during its growth?

Data privacy and security concerns is a key challenge affecting the industry growth.

  • In today's business landscape, data security is a paramount concern for organizations as they transition to cloud-based applications and services, including Factory Automation Platforms. Advanced security features are increasingly in demand to mitigate risks such as man-in-the-middle (MiTM) attacks and secure socket layer (SSL) connection vulnerabilities. However, despite advancements in cloud security, threats persist, including DDoS attacks, data breaches, unsecured APIs, data loss, and account hijacking. Enterprises require professional services to address these challenges and ensure compliance with data security policies.
